A user friendly query tree building library for Trino, a distributed SQL query engine. Treeno supports python>=3.6, and aims to support Trino v368 grammar. This project is currently in development and new features are added frequently.

Quick Start

CLI

You can use treeno to format your SQL queries:

❯ treeno format query "SELECT a,b FROM (SELECT a, b, c FROM t WHERE c > 5 AND b = 2 ORDER BY a) LIMIT 3;"
SELECT "a","b"
  FROM (SELECT "a","b","c"
          FROM "t"
         WHERE "c" > 5
               AND "b" = 2
         ORDER BY "a")
 LIMIT 3

treeno antlr-tree allows you to view the SQL syntax as a raw antlr tree to better understand your query structure:

❯ treeno antlr-tree expression "1+2"
          standaloneExpres
                sion
   ______________|________________
  |                           expression
  |                               |
  |                        booleanExpressio
  |                               n
  |                               |
  |                        valueExpression
  |     __________________________|________________
  |    |                   valueExpression  valueExpression
  |    |                          |                |
  |    |                   primaryExpressio primaryExpressio
  |    |                          n                n
  |    |                          |                |
  |    |                        number           number
  |    |                          |                |
<EOF>  +                          1                2

treeno tree allows you to view the SQL syntax as treeno's native objects which provide a partially typed and compressed alternative to that of the raw ANTLR grammar:

❯ treeno tree query "SELECT COUNT(*) FROM t LIMIT 10"
                              SelectQuery
   ________________________________|_______________________________
  |        |                     select                 |          |
  |        |                       |                    |          |
  |        |                     Count                  |          |
  |        |            ___________|____________        |          |
  |        |           |           |          value   from_        |
  |        |           |           |            |       |          |
limit with_queries data_type null_treatment data_type  name select_quantifie
  |        |           |           |            |       |          r
  |        |           |           |            |       |          |
  10      ...        BIGINT  NullTreatment.  UNKNOWN    t    SetQuantifier.
                                RESPECT                           ALL

Library

treeno.builder.convert supplies three useful functions query_from_sql, expression_from_sql and type_from_sql, which allows us to parse Trino SQL into python data types.

Underneath the hood, every expression is a Value, which has a sql() function which gives us the string representation of the query.

Support for joins:

>>> query = query_from_sql("SELECT foo.a, t.b FROM t INNER JOIN foo ON foo.a = t.b")
>>> print(query.sql(PrintOptions(PrintMode.PRETTY)))
SELECT "foo"."a","t"."b"
  FROM "t" INNER JOIN "foo" ON "foo"."a" = "t"."b"
>>> print(str(query))
SELECT "foo"."a","t"."b" FROM "t" INNER JOIN "foo" ON "foo"."a" = "t"."b"

Support for basic window functions:

>>> query = query_from_sql("SELECT SUM(a) OVER (PARTITION BY date ORDER BY timestamp ROWS BETWEEN 5 PRECEDING AND CURRENT ROW), x, y, z FROM t")
>>> print(query.sql(PrintOptions(PrintMode.PRETTY)))
SELECT SUM("a") OVER (
       PARTITION BY "date"
           ORDER BY "timestamp"
            ROWS BETWEEN 5 PRECEDING AND CURRENT ROW),
       "x","y","z"
  FROM "t"
>>> print(query)
SELECT SUM("a") OVER (PARTITION BY "date" ORDER BY "timestamp" ROWS BETWEEN 5 PRECEDING AND CURRENT ROW),"x","y","z" FROM "t"

Support for subqueries:

>>> query = query_from_sql("SELECT a FROM (SELECT a,b FROM (SELECT a,b,c FROM t))")
>>> print(str(query))
SELECT "a" FROM (SELECT "a","b" FROM (SELECT "a","b","c" FROM "t"))
>>> print(query.sql(PrintOptions(PrintMode.PRETTY)))
SELECT "a"
  FROM (SELECT "a","b"
          FROM (SELECT "a","b","c"
                  FROM "t"))

Support for CTE's:

>>> query = query_from_sql("WITH foo AS (SELECT a,b FROM t) SELECT foo.a")
>>> print(query.sql(PrintOptions(PrintMode.PRETTY)))
  WITH "foo" AS (
       SELECT "a","b"
         FROM "t")
SELECT "foo"."a"
>>> print(str(query))
WITH "foo" AS (SELECT "a","b" FROM "t") SELECT "foo"."a"

Support for all pemdas:

>>> query = query_from_sql("SELECT (((1+2)*3)/4)-10")
>>> print(str(query)) # only + needs parenthesizing
SELECT (1 + 2) * 3 / 4 - 10
>> query = query_from_sql("SELECT (TRUE OR TRUE) AND FALSE")
>>> print(str(query)) # AND has precedence, so we preserve the parentheses
SELECT (TRUE OR TRUE) AND FALSE
>>> query = query_from_sql("SELECT TRUE OR (TRUE AND FALSE)")
>>> print(str(query)) # AND has precedence so parentheses are redundant
SELECT TRUE OR TRUE AND FALSE

treeno is type-aware:

>>> query = query_from_sql("SELECT CAST(3 AS DECIMAL(29,1))")
>>> print(str(query))
SELECT CAST(3 AS DECIMAL(29,1))

The above decimal type can be constructed in python using the treeno.datatypes.builder module:

>>> from treeno.datatypes.builder import decimal
>>> decimal(precision=29, scale=1)
DataType(type_name='DECIMAL', parameters={'precision': 29, 'scale': 1})

First time setup

  • Create a virtualenv/conda environment
  • Fork the repository by clicking "Fork" on the main repo on the top right corner.
  • Clone the main repository locally
$ git clone git@github.com:OneRaynyDay/treeno.git
$ cd treeno
  • If you don't have ANTLR installed, do so first. On Mac OS X you can run:
# This should give you version 4.9.2
$ brew install antlr@4
  • Build the repository locally (this will build ANTLR)
$ python setup.py develop

To run tests, please run:

$ pytest
